User Experience (UX) Design Roles refer to the various positions within a team responsible for designing and improving the overall user experience of a product or service.
Key Features
- UI/UX Designer
- Interaction Designer
- User Researcher
- Information Architect
- Usability Analyst
Pros
- Dedicated roles focused on enhancing user satisfaction and usability
- Specialized skill sets for different aspects of the design process
- Helps in creating products that are intuitive and user-friendly
Cons
- Can lead to siloed work if roles are not well-defined or communication is lacking
- May require additional resources and budget to hire specialized designers
- Constant need for collaboration and coordination among different roles
